The Sukhbaatar Statue, located in the heart of Ulaanbaatar, is a prominent historical landmark that pays homage to one of Mongolia's most revered national heroes, Damdin Sukhbaatar. Erected in 1946, this impressive bronze statue depicts Sukhbaatar on horseback, holding a raised sword, symbolizing the fight for Mongolia’s independence from foreign rule. The statue stands proudly in Sukhbaatar Square, which serves as a central gathering place for both locals and tourists. The square is surrounded by significant government buildings and cultural institutions, making it a vibrant hub of activity.
